Special Education

Auburn's Special Education Department is dedicated to providing a free and appropriate individual educational programming for school-age students from the ages of three to twenty years of age.

Special Education programs are written by a team of people focusing on the individual needs of each student. Students must be identified under one of the following disability categories as defined by the Federal Regulations, Indivduals with Disabilities Education Act, and Maine Department of Education Regulations:

    • Autism

    • Deaf-Blindnes,

    • Deafness

    • Emotional Disturbance

    • Hearing Impairment

    • Cognitive Impairment

    • Orthopedic Impairment

    • Other Health Impairment

    • Specific Learning Disabilities

    • Traumatic Brain Injury

    • Visual Impairment including Blindness

    • and in need of specially designed instruction to be eligible to receive special education services.
